Other types of insurance that could apply in personal injury cases include: Workers’ compensation insurance for a work-related injury Homeowners’ insurance and business liability insurance policies in case of a slip and fall accident or premises liability claim  Medical malpractice insurance when a doctor or medical provider is negligent or makes a medical mistake Property damage insurance coverage for car accidents Commercial liability insurance to cover… [read post]

Notice Regarding Colorado HOA Homeowners’ Rights Task Force On May 24, 2023, Governor Polis signed into law HB23-1105, which creates an HOA Homeowners’ Rights Task Force (“Task Force”) to examine issues confronting communities that are governed by the executive board of an association. [read post]
